Planting Calendar for Sorrel

Frost tolerance for sorrel: Tolerant of some frost.
When to plant: Up to 5 weeks before last frost.

Sorrel can survive in mild cold which tells us that you can plant them a bit earlier in the year than more sensitive plants.

The earliest that you can plant sorrel in Burlington is February. However, you really should wait until March if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ant sorrel and expect a good harvest is probably September. Any later than that and your sorrel may not have a chance to grow to maturity. Starting your sorrel indoors is a great way to get them started a few weeks earlier.

Last Frost Date

In Burlington the average date of last frost happens on April 15. In the coldest months of winter you should expect an average low temperature of 0°F.

Always keep in mind that USDA zone info for Burlington is not always accurate and the actual date of last frost changes from year to year. Half of the time in Burlington you get surprised by a frost after April 15 so make sure that you are prepared to cover your sorrel in the event of one of those late frosts.
